Amavida Salary

As of July 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Amavida in the United States is $30.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$61,417. Salaries at Amavida typically range from $26 to $34 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About AMAVIDA
"Amavida" joins the Spanish words "amar" (to love) and "vida" (life). The name "Amavida" was adopted by our company after extensive soul searching to define who we are and what beliefs and values are most important to us. What Is the Cost of Living Near Tallahassee?

Understanding the cost of living near Tallahassee is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Amavida.
Tallahassee's Cost of Living Index is approximately 92.3 (7.7% less expensive than US average; 10.5% less than FL average). State capital, university town (FSU/FAMU), relatively affordable housing for FL. StarMetro b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Amavida,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of Amavida sal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$35 (StarMetro mon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$630+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$350 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,245 - $3,605+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
